Could a High-Fat diet help brain tumor patients?

NCT ID NCT05428852

First seen Jun 27,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026

Summary

This study looks at whether a ketogenic (high-fat, low-carb) diet is practical and beneficial for 24 adults with brain metastases who are scheduled for radiosurgery. Participants will follow either a ketogenic diet or a standard healthy diet for 16 weeks. Researchers will track diet adherence, blood markers, and quality of life to see if the diet helps manage symptoms and improve well-being.
